The moon on Thursday, May 4, 2006
The Moon phase on Thursday, May 4, 2006 is First Quarter with an illumination of 50.2%. This indicates the percentage of the Moon illuminated by the Sun. On Thursday, May 4, 2006, the Moon is 7.4 days old. This number shows how many days have passed since the last New Moon.
